Macroeconomic Study Reveals Crime Imposes $405B 'Security Tax' on Global Productivity
Summary
The article argues that crime creates a large hidden economic burden by forcing businesses and governments to spend heavily on security, insurance, and loss prevention. It cites global physical security and retail shrinkage figures to show how defensive spending reduces productive investment. It also presents MyTSV.com’s nationwide expansion as a response to trust deficits in local commerce. For software and service vendors, the piece signals continued demand for security, verification, and directory-style trust infrastructure.
